M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
studies
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
e-learning have enabled
students
in every nation on earth
to take courses online.
MOOC classes are
ordinar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
technology-enhanced learning organizations
are having to consider
now that e-learning technology is
advancing so swiftly.
How can institutions
be assured that
the education provided by these
MOOC courses is
passable?
How can institutions
guarantee that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ified for online teaching?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Yale University to conduct these MOOC classes?
What assessment strategies and innovative teaching practices are in use today?
How can institutions
deal with
inadequate
student motivation and high
student attrition?
